Around 40 years old and of traditional construction, this link detached house is situated within a cul de sac in the heart of this highly sought after and well served village.
Ipplepen is located around 4 miles from the market town of Newton Abbot and 5 miles from the historic town of Totnes famous for its bohemian atmosphere. Both towns are accessible via timetabled bus services from the village and have main line railway stations. The village offers a vibrant and active lifestyle opportunity with many clubs and societies. Within around 500 meters walk from the house are a first-class range of amenities including a primary school, modern health centre, popular local inn/restaurant, coffee shop, ancient church, play park, tennis courts, bowling club and a small supermarket.
Accommodation
Stepping inside the accommodation is light and airy and offers a degree of versatility. A good-sized enclosed porch with tiled floor leads through to the entrance hallway with stairs to the first floor and a recessed fitted cloaks cupboard. Overlooking the front with a view down the cul de sac is the kitchen with a comprehensive range of fitted cabinets and a door to outside with a pathway leading around to the rear garden. At the rear is a well-proportioned living room with floor mounted wood burning stove and a double-glazed patio door opening to a lovely uPVC frame double-glazed conservatory which overlooks and has doors opening to the rear garden. Also on the ground floor is bedroom 3 which is a good double size, adjacent to which and accessed from the hallway is a shower room with basin and WC. Both the living room and bedroom have stylish part vaulted ceilings with roof windows providing plenty of natural light.
Moving up to the first floor there are 2 further bedrooms the principal with deep recessed fitted wardrobes and separate airing cupboard and a family bathroom with WC and basin.
Gardens
The property has a surprisingly private and level enclosed garden at the rear which has been landscaped with ease of maintenance in mind and provides a lovely setting for outdoor entertaining and al fresco dining.
Parking
An attached single garage and driveway provide ample parking.
